Bicycle Involved in Accident on Flagstaff Road in Boulder BOULDER, CO (July 16, 2024) – The Boulder County Sheriff’s Office confirmed that one person suffered injuries in a bicycle accident in the 4113 block of Flagstaff Road on June 26. According to the Colorado State Patrol, the crash happened at approximately 7:40 AM....
Home » Accident on Flagstaff Road